Last weeks’ “This Book Needs a New Family Giveaway” was so much fun, I decided to do it again. And may continue until this stack of books next to my bookshelf has disappeared. Next up is a book I have some history with: Among Schoolchildren, by Tracy Kidder.
This book spent some well-deserved time on the national bestseller list, quite an accomplishment for a book about American education. It was required reading in my college education courses and was one of the few books I have been assigned that I actually read from cover to cover. In fact year later, as a Teach for America corps member in the Rio Grande Valley, I would be reminded of Mrs. Zajac’s fifth grade class, the poor area she taught in and the life she poured into her students.
I had tried to remember the title, wanted to recommend it to a friend, thought I might like to read it again myself. But I couldn’t remember the title or enough specific details to find any information and thought it lost to the blur that was my college life. Then what should I discover at the library book sale last fall but this very book?! And what should I discover in all my boxes of books in the attic but this very book?! And while I like it an awful lot, I really don’t need two copies.
So I hope one of you might enjoy it as much as I.
